Schwab, Jack Earl Sr.

Passed on Wednesday April 27th, 2022. Beloved husband of the late Ruth Schwab; dear father of Jack Jr. (Lisa) and Michael (Sandy); dear grandfather of Benjamin, Matthew, Jacob, Andrew, Adam, Nicholas, and Margaret. Dear great-grandfather of Jude, Jack, Scottie, and Harrison.

Services: Memorial Visitation and Funeral at St. Paul’s United Church of Christ (Telegraph Rd.) Thursday May 5th, 9AM until funeral service at 10AM Internment J.B National Cemetery. In lieu of flowers, contributions made to the deGreeff Hospice House are appreciated. Kutis South County Service.
